Abstract
The utility model discloses a kind of Concealable vehicle insulation guardrail, includes Telescopic guardrail, harboring holes, motor housing, motor, embedded threading pipe, data transmission terminal, reflective top cover, water proof rubber pad, warning light;Telescopic guardrail is formed by two sections, and every section stackable to be hidden in the harboring holes of rsvp path;Reflective top cover is rubber fluorescent retroreflective top cover, is connected with Telescopic guardrail top, and the corner alarm operating lamp of reflective top cover, warning light is connected with data transmission terminal;Telescopic guardrail lower end is embedded with motor housing, and motor housing is flexible up and down by motor driven Telescopic guardrail built with motor;Data transmission terminal is connected with vehicle flow monitoring device, and sending instruction by data analysis starts motor and warning light;Guardrail end, which is provided with, is oriented to arrow.The vehicle insulation guardrail of a kind of intelligent distinguishing vehicle flowrate of the present utility model and automatic telescopic, the utilization rate of road is improved, the problem of peak period vehicle congestion, solving road imbalance congestion can be alleviated.

Technical field
It the utility model is related to a kind of highway layout traffic safety facilities, and in particular to Concealable vehicle insulation guardrail.
Background technology
With the rapid development of economy, urbanization speed is accelerated, the traffic that the rapid growth of vehicle is brought to urban road
Pressure is growing, and the road in original city can not meet that the consequence needed for current vehicle, thus brought is exactly urban transportation
Congestion getting worse, in peak period on and off duty and festivals or holidays etc., particular time is especially prominent.
The planning of China most cities at present all takes region centralization, such as residential block to concentrate on a region, does
The problem of public area concentrates on another region, and early evening peak congestion then occurs in road between these two regions, in morning
Peak period, there is the road traffic of residential block toward Administrative Area side very big, congestion occur, and the vehicle flowrate of opposite side road
Very little;The evening peak period is then very big by Office Area return residential area side road traffic, and congestion is serious, opposite side terrain vehicle
Flow very little, the uneven congestion problems thus brought can cause that organizing vehicles are unreasonable, road utilization rate is insufficient, so as to
The running time of people on the way is added, so not only causes vehicle exhaust discharge quantity to increase, air is polluted, also wastes
The substantial amounts of time.
For this phenomenon, some external cities employ removable zip mode isolation strip, are moved by supporting vehicle
Dynamic isolation strip, so as to realize to the mutual conversion to track, solving road imbalance congestion problems.But the isolating device can not
It is fixed on road, for conveyance vehicle during being changed, traveling is slower, is difficult to control linear, it is necessary to manually be repaiied
Just, so as to larger to artificial demand.
A kind of packaged type isolation strip of some domestic expert designs, by computer controls isolation strip to be moved by a track
To another track, and roller is provided with below isolation strip, however, this kind of isolation strip can not be fixed on road, in strong wind, rain
The bad weathers such as snow descend, and isolation strip is easy to deviate shielding wire to track region, and serious potential safety hazard is caused to driving vehicle.
It is the number of track-lines that two-way lane is controlled by signal lamp that, which there be some designs the country, and this make it that vehicle is easy in the process of moving
Ignore signal and be strayed into to track.
The content of the invention
The utility model is to solve above-mentioned road imbalance congestion problems, there is provided a kind of intelligent distinguishing vehicle flowrate is simultaneously
Concealable vehicle insulation guardrail, so as to improve the utilization rate of road, alleviate peak period vehicle congestion problem.
The utility model solves the problems, such as, mainly using following technical scheme:
The solution method of road peak period imbalance congestion problems, left and right is controlled by a kind of Concealable vehicle insulation guardrail
Road width number of track-lines, it is characterised in that the linking-up road traffic monitoring equipment of data transmission terminal equipment 6, according to traffic monitoring equipment
The vehicle flowrate data judging track congestion level included simultaneously sends instruction, and corresponding vehicle insulation is turned on and off by motor 4
Guardrail, so as to increase the number of track-lines of congestion road width side, the number of track-lines of unimpeded road width side is reduced, makes full use of road width, alleviated
Two-way unbalanced traffic, alleviate traffic pressure.
Described Concealable vehicle insulation guardrail is made up of sheet metal, is formed up and down by two sections, and every section stackable hiding
In rsvp path harboring holes 5, width is 15cm, hypomere height 30cm, wide 20cm after hiding;Epimere is highly 25cm, is exposed
The highly common 55cm of road surface;Length is 2m, and one is set every 4m, is set with roadmarking consistent.Edge at the top of per section guard plate
Both sides length direction sets water proof rubber pad 8, prevents water from entering inside device.
Described guardrail top surface is reflective top cover 7 made of the reflective frosted rubber of yellow or white, and road center is isolated
Band is yellow, and both sides isolation strip is white, when guardrail is hidden in road surface, may act as pavement strip, wear-resisting reliable, solving road
While congestion, can solve reflecting effect of the pavement strip for a long time after vehicle exercises abrasion.Guardrail top surface corner sets resistance to
The warning light 9 of pressure, keep flashing and sending alarm in guardrail telescopic process, remind vehicle deceleration to go slowly.Guardrail end is set
Have and be oriented to arrow 10, guiding vehicle drives into correct track.
Described Concealable vehicle insulation guardrail, can be in number when traffic temporary control or big anticipation relief bus flow
According to transmission terminal 6 by manually starting guard bar device, increase and decrease road width number of track-lines is judged according to road traffic is actual.Data transmission terminal
6 are arranged on both sides of the road pavement or curb.

Embodiment
A kind of Concealable vehicle insulation guardrail, is applied on the road more than the two-way four-lane of city, including flexible shield
Column 1, the guardrail is steel guard rail, and is made up of two sections, and upper-lower section is stackable flexible and is hidden in reserved harboring holes, stretches
By providing power mounted in the motor 4 of pre-buried motor housing 3, motor 4 is whole by embedded threading pipe and data transfer for the realization of contracting function
The connection of end 6, the linking-up road traffic monitoring equipment of data transmission terminal 6, the vehicle flowrate number included according to vehicle flow monitoring device
According to judgement track congestion level and instruction is sent, corresponding vehicle insulation guardrail is turned on and off by motor 4, gathered around so as to increase
The number of track-lines of stifled road width side, reduces the number of track-lines of unimpeded road width side, makes full use of road width, alleviate two-way unbalanced traffic,
Alleviate traffic pressure.
Telescopic guardrail is made up of sheet metal, is formed up and down by two sections, and every section stackable to be hidden in rsvp path harboring holes 5
In, width is 15cm, hypomere height 30cm, wide 20cm after hiding;Epimere is highly 25cm, exposes the highly common 55cm of road surface;
Length is 2m, and one is set every 4m, is set with roadmarking consistent.Set and prevent along both sides length direction at the top of per section guard plate
Water rubber blanket 8, prevent water from entering inside device.
Guardrail top surface reflective top cover 7, road center Concealable car made of the reflective frosted rubber of yellow or white
Isolation guardrail is yellow, and the concealed vehicle insulation guardrail in both sides is white, when guardrail is hidden in road surface, may act as road marking
Line, it is wear-resisting reliable, can solve appearance of the pavement strip for a long time after vehicle traveling abrasion while solving road congestion
The unintelligible problem of graticule.Guardrail top surface corner sets pressure-resistant warning light 9, keeps flashing and sending in guardrail telescopic process
Alarm, vehicle deceleration is reminded to go slowly.Guardrail end, which is provided with, is oriented to arrow 10, and guiding vehicle drives into correct track.
Described Concealable vehicle insulation guardrail, can when there is traffic temporary control or anticipation relief bus flow is big
Guard bar device is manually started in data transmission terminal 6, judges increase and decrease road width number of track-lines according to road traffic is actual.Data transfer is whole
End 6 is arranged on both sides of the road pavement or curb.
Judged as shown in figure 4, the data exported by traffic monitoring equipment are sent to data transmission terminal 6, work as a left side
When the congestion of width track and few right side vehicle flowrate, data transmission terminal sends instruction, left width road guard and road center guardrail
To close, warning light flashes and sends alarm, is hidden in road, and the reflective top cover 7 of guardrail is concordant with road surface, serves as pavement strip,
Meanwhile right-hand lane guardrail is opened, warning light flashes and sends alarm, such as Fig. 4;When the congestion of right width track and left side vehicle flowrate is few
When, data transmission terminal sends instruction, and right width road guard is closed with road center guardrail, and warning light flashes and sends alarm,
It is hidden in road, the reflective top cover 7 of guardrail is concordant with road surface, serves as pavement strip, meanwhile, left width lane guardrail is opened, alarm
Lamp flashes and sends alarm, such as Fig. 5;When both sides simultaneously congestion or it is simultaneously unimpeded when, then road center guardrail open, guardrails of both sides
Close, be hidden in road, such as Fig. 6.
